Summary
Overview
Work History
Education
Skills
Websites
Certification
Timeline
Generic

Uma Nath Jha

Bengaluru

Summary

Experienced software engineer specializing in Java development with around 8+ years of experience. Proficient in Java, Spring Framework, Spring Boot, REST Web Services, SQL Server, Docker, AWS Cloud (Certified Practitioner), Icinga2, RabbitMQ, Python. Skilled in leading teams, managing projects, and delivering results aligned with organizational goals.

Overview

9
9
years of professional experience
1
1
Certification

Work History

Senior Software Engineer

JPMorgan Chase
08.2024 - Current
  • Implemented Datadog traceability for Chase offer experience service
  • Fine-tuned AWS ECS set-up for performance testing of Chase offer experience service
  • Code review and improvements in Chase offer experience service.

Senior Software Engineer

Newgen Digital Works
02.2020 - 07.2024
  • Health Monitoring project is a monitoring platform built using Icinga2(Nagios) for monitoring their infrastructure and alerting the support team to resolve the issues on time by publishing the warning/critical events for hosts/services
  • Designed and Developed a Health Monitoring(H&M) platform for monitoring health of servers and applications, using Icinga2 as monitoring tool, RabbitMQ as message broker and Java Spring boot agents as notification framework
  • Developed Java REST endpoints for consuming error events and health metrics from applications
  • Developed python plugins to fetch health info from remote servers
  • Dockerized and Migrated H&M platform to AWS cloud using ECS, OpenSearch, RDS and AmazonMQ
  • Spearheaded a two-member team, effectively distributing tasks, monitoring code quality, and providing constructive feedback, thereby driving team performance and value
  • Spearheaded migration initiatives for other projects from traditional data centers to AWS, resulting in reduced operational overheads and improved scalability
  • Led code reviews to ensure adherence to coding standards while providing constructive feedback to peers.

Lead Backend Developer

ThoughtClan Technologies
11.2016 - 02.2020
  • Assist was a tenant-based product used by Client business for automating the inspection/observation by field engineers at construction sites
  • Ideated and developed Spring boot applications to migrate data and meta data from MS SQL server to Mongo DB
  • Developed groovy scripts for process steps for Activiti workflows
  • Implemented SAP yMarketing for e-commerce platform
  • Ideated and Developed Java Spring boot applications for validating, formatting, and importing customer and transactional data into SAP
  • Ideated and Developed REST APIs using SAP HCI integration flows in groovy
  • Integrated email outbound service using AWS SES, SNS and SQS
  • Travelled to Germany and UK to work with clients to gather business requirements and provide technical solutions.

Programmer Analyst Trainee

Cognizant Technologies Solutions
04.2016 - 11.2016
  • Got trained in Java and AEM
  • Developed AEM components using Java.

Education

B. Tech - Information Technology

FIEM - Kolkata

Skills

  • Java
  • Spring
  • REST APIs
  • Microservices
  • SQL Server
  • AWS ECS/ECR, EC2, ELB, S3, SQS, CloudFormation
  • Docker & K8s
  • CI/CD Bamboo
  • Python
  • Icinga2
  • RabbitMQ
  • Elasticsearch
  • SAFe Agile

Certification

AWS Certified Cloud Practitioner, https://www.credly.com/badges/515b2ce1-721e-48fa-b226-33aeef1f561c/public_url

Timeline

Senior Software Engineer

JPMorgan Chase
08.2024 - Current

Senior Software Engineer

Newgen Digital Works
02.2020 - 07.2024

Lead Backend Developer

ThoughtClan Technologies
11.2016 - 02.2020

Programmer Analyst Trainee

Cognizant Technologies Solutions
04.2016 - 11.2016

B. Tech - Information Technology

FIEM - Kolkata
Uma Nath Jha